A PHASE 1B, MULTIPLE ASCENDING DOSE TRIAL EXAMINING THE SAFETY AND TOLERABILITY OF SUBCUTANEOUS MANP IN DIFFICULT TO CONTROL/RESISTANT HYPERTENSIVE SUBJECTS


Qualified Participants Must:

• Must be 18 to 80
• Have a BMI between 18 to 40
• Have a blood pressure of 130/80 or higher (if you have diabetes) or have a blood pressure of 140/90 or higher (if you do not have diabetes)
• Must be taking at least 3 or more blood pressure medication (At least 1 of the medications must be a diuetic/water pill)
• Must be willing to complete a 7 day/6 night stay at the research center.

Clinical trials are medical research studies designed to test the safety and/or effectiveness of new investigational drugs, devices, or treatments in humans.
